预览加载中,请您耐心等待几秒...
1/3
2/3
3/3

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于计算思维的大学计算机课程改革与实践 基于计算思维的大学计算机课程改革与实践 摘要:随着信息技术的快速发展和社会对计算能力的需求不断增加,计算思维作为一种关键的思维方式已经成为当今大学计算机课程教学改革的重要方向。本文从计算思维的概念和特点出发,探讨了基于计算思维的大学计算机课程改革的意义与必要性,并提出了相关的实践策略和措施。 一、引言 计算思维是指通过使用计算机科学的概念、方法和工具来解决问题的一种思维方式。计算思维强调的是对问题的分析和抽象能力、算法设计和实现能力以及信息处理和表达能力。随着信息技术的快速发展和计算能力需求的不断增加,计算思维已经成为当今社会中全民必备的一种能力。而大学计算机课程作为培养学生计算思维的主要途径之一,需要进行相应的改革与实践。 二、基于计算思维的大学计算机课程改革的意义与必要性 2.1适应社会需求 随着信息技术的广泛应用,越来越多的行业和职业对计算思维能力的要求越来越高。因此,培养大学生的计算思维能力已成为大学计算机课程改革的迫切需求。基于计算思维的大学计算机课程改革可以使学生获得更加全面和深入的计算思维能力,从而更好地适应社会需求。 2.2培养创新能力 计算思维是一种创造性的思维方式,它要求学生具备分析问题、设计算法、实现代码和解决问题的能力。大学计算机课程改革应该注重培养学生的创新能力,让学生在问题解决的过程中能够灵活运用计算思维,提出创新的解决方案。 2.3提高学科认知水平 计算思维不仅仅是一种解决问题的方法,更是一种学科认知的方式。通过学习计算机课程,学生可以了解计算机科学的基本知识和方法,更加深入地认识计算机科学的内涵。因此,基于计算思维的大学计算机课程改革可以提高学生的学科认知水平。 三、基于计算思维的大学计算机课程改革的实践策略与措施 3.1强化计算思维的培养 基于计算思维的大学计算机课程改革应该将计算思维的培养贯穿于整个课程教学过程中。具体来说,教师可以通过提供大量的问题和实例,激发学生的思维活动,并引导学生运用计算思维解决问题。同时,通过组织编程比赛和项目实践等活动,培养学生的算法设计和实现能力。 3.2引入跨学科的内容 计算思维作为一种跨学科的思维方式,可以与其他学科结合起来,形成更加有趣和有实际意义的学习内容。在大学计算机课程中引入跨学科的内容,既可以提高学生对计算机知识的兴趣和学习动力,又可以培养学生的计算思维能力。 3.3注重实践教学和项目实践 计算机课程的实践教学和项目实践是培养学生计算思维能力的重要途径。通过实践教学和项目实践,学生可以将所学的理论知识应用到实际问题的解决中,提高学生的算法设计和实现能力,并培养学生的团队合作和创新能力。 四、总结 基于计算思维的大学计算机课程改革与实践是适应社会需求、培养学生创新能力和提高学科认知水平的重要途径。通过强化计算思维的培养、引入跨学科的内容以及注重实践教学和项目实践等策略和措施,可以有效地提高大学计算机课程的教学质量和学生的综合能力。因此,大学计算机课程改革与实践应该紧跟计算思维的发展趋势,不断改进和创新,以满足社会和学生的需求。